我有一种情况,我正在查找的信息,每条记录都有自己的度量标准。因此,指标/阈值包含在a表中,并分配给变量。为了用它们自己的格式正确地显示它们(即Red Threshold = Red),我需要能够对变量运行If/Then或Switch语句。这是我编写的测试代码: switch (true) {
case (txtYel_Threshold): // represents for this one
我正在进行一次迁移,使用Crystal中的一些报告元素,并尝试将以前存在的内容转换为SQL。它看起来像是使用VB脚本,但我想不出该怎么切换。最初,我假设一条CASE WHEN语句就足够了,但是我无法确定查询背后的正确逻辑。我有一些psuedo,我想应该以同样的方式工作,但这不能解决,因为你不能在CASE WHEN语句中设置变量(我相信): DECLARE HasValue BIT
CASE
我正在尝试在select语句(SQL Server2008)中使用变量,但遇到了一些困难。我已经在下面包含了我的代码。IN ('x', 'y' ,'z') then 1 ELSE 0 END) as "Default",
SUM(CASE WHEN @newFieldName NOT IN ('x', 'y' ,'z') then 1 ELSE 0 END) as